Celebrated yoga teacher and activist Seane Corn shares pivotal accounts of her life with raw
honesty-enriched with in-depth spiritual teachings-to help us heal evolve and change the
world. My first lessons in spirituality and yoga had nothing to do with a mat but everything
to do with waking up. They included angels seeing God and being in Heaven. But believe me
not the way you might think. So begins Revolution of the Soul. What comes next reads like a
riveting memoir filled with uncensored moments of joy pain wonder and humor. Except this
book is so much more than that. Seane's real purpose is to guide us into a deep gut-level
understanding of our highest Self through yoga philosophy and other tools for emotional
healing-not just as abstract ideas but as embodied fully felt wisdom. Why? To spark a
revolution of the soul in each of us so that we can awaken to our purpose and become true
agents of change. To take us there she shares the highlights lowlights and what-the-Fs of
her own evolution including: . How in the gritty clubs and cafes of New York's 1980s East
Village Seane meets the first everyday angels that will change her path forever . Her first
yoga classes (with dirty sweats Marlboros and the mother of all monkey minds in tow) . How a
variety of unconventional therapists masterfully helped Seane embrace her shadow and resolve
her childhood trauma OCD unhealthy behaviors and relationship wounding . A pilgrimage to
India where Seane receives stinging truths about false gurus and our need to trust the teacher
within . How she comes to understand the connection between the inner work of transformation
and the outer work of social change . And many other stories each illuminated by immersive
teachings When we heal the fractured parts of ourselves and learn to love who we are and the
journey we've embarked upon writes Seane we will see that same tender humanity in all souls.
This is the revolution of the soul. With this book you're invited to be a part of it.
